Description | Information: Human CD49d molecules are integrin alpha4 chains that are expressed as heterodimers with CD29 (beta1 integrin) or (beta7 integrin) and function as adhesion receptors. CD49d/CD29 is mainly expressed on thymocytes and B cells with increased expression on activated T cells. The ligands for CD49d/CD29 include VCAM-1 and fibronectin. Antibody BU49 recognizes the CD49d molecule of about 145 kd. |
